Telangana accounted for nearly 70% of all serious coal mine accidents in India in 2025, according to data tabled in the Lok Sabha. Of 119 serious accidents recorded across nine coal-bearing states, 80 occurred in Telangana. Over the three-year period from 2023 to 2025, the state recorded 233 of 355 serious accidents nationally, leaving 235 workers injured.

The state also accounted for 17 of 141 coal mine fatalities between 2023 and 2025, with six deaths in 2023, eight in 2024, and three in 2025. Injuries ranged from loss of sight or hearing to fractures, caused by falls, explosives, landslides, and equipment failures. Singareni Collieries Company Limited (SCCL) officials attributed the high numbers to accurate reporting, noting that 90% of accidents stem from human negligence or non-adherence to safety protocols.

Coal India Limited and its subsidiaries, including SCCL, are the country's largest coal producers. The data highlights a persistent safety challenge: while reporting improvements may partly explain Telangana's high numbers, the fatal accident rate of 17 deaths in three years is the hard metric that matters. The Directorate General of Mines Safety (DGMS) sets safety standards and investigates serious accidents. The next test will be whether SCCL's own admission of human negligence leads to enforceable measures or remains a routine explanation. Watch for the 2026 annual DGMS report to see if Telangana's share falls after any corrective action.
